    Abstract
    This infographic shows the ranking of the topic out of the 15 topics monitored (8/15), the percentage of total time spent on the topic (4.7%), the number of MPs who contributed to the topic (186), and the top 5 contributing MPs along with the productive time they spent on the topic: C.B. Rathnayake (4.1%), Mahinda Amaraweera (3.4%), S.M. Chandrasena (3.2%), Charles Nirmalanathan (2.6%), and Pavithradevi Wanniarachchi (2.2%). It also provides the number of times the Ministerial Consultative Committee (MCC) on Environment met (7 times in 41 months). Additionally, a breakdown is showcased of the transitions of Environment Ministers during the 9th Parliament.
